About 85 Chisbury Close
85 Chisbury Close is a one-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Bracknell (RG12 0SF). It has a recorded floor area of 40 m² (around 431 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(November 2021) shows an E (score 47),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. Earlier certificates rated it D (January 2012);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Poor to Very Good; while hot-water efficiency dropped from Poor to Very Poor and main heating dropped from Average to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to A (score 94), a 4-band jump. Main heating runs on to be used only when there is no heating/hot.
Across 1997–2012, sale prices on this property compounded at 7.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£232,000 sits 65.7% above the 2012 sale of £140,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£325/sq ft) was about 21.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sold in April 2012, so it's been off the market for around 14 years. Across the public record there are 5 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. At 40 m² it's 28.6%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(56 m² median across 26 EPCs). It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 81% of similar EPCs).
